Learning more about car DIY can help you keep your car maintenance cost down and teach you some useful abilities. While there are some sophisticated jobs that are best left to specialists, there are lots of simple car maintenance tips you can follow to do some tasks yourself. For example, you can quickly replace your oil in your own garage without having to take the automobile to a mechanic. Not only will this save check here you time, however also cash otherwise paid to a professional. Topping coolant is likewise a basic enough task that anybody can do even if they are not really knowledgeable. This is a necessary task that you must not delay as having precariously low levels of coolant can cause your car to get too hot and may result in more expensive engine repair work. While there are numerous important maintenance jobs that you must stay on top of, one of the more important ones is tyre maintenance. Not only does your tyre health have a direct effect on performance, however it can likewise be a safety problem if it degrades. When it comes to tyres, among the very best practices is to guarantee that your tyre pressure is at the proper levels. You will find this information on the driver's door panel or in the car maintenance book issued by the manufacturer. Another great practice is to rotate your tyres if they're still in good condition. This just means swapping their locations to get the most use of them. Examining your tyre tread depth routinely is likewise important as you need to make sure that the tread depth does not go lower than the 1.6 mm legal limit.
